(Jun. 24, 2024) — My wife, son and I recently took a 12-day road trip to the western United States. We traveled 5,830 miles, visiting 10 states and one Canadian province.

We passed through fertile farmland, prairie, desert and mountains. We went to historical sites and famous cities. We saw elk, pronghorn antelope and sea lions.

We visited Crater Lake National Park. Crater Lake was a volcano which collapsed thousands of years ago and became a lake, the deepest in the United States.

We drove through the California Redwoods and saw the Pacific Ocean.

We visited Yellowstone, America’s first national park, and saw Old Faithful erupt.
